当前位置:网站首页 >服务类小程序 > 正文

简易小程序开发例子

小虎牙 小虎牙 . 发布于 2025-06-10 21:09:32 57 浏览

简易小程序开发例子 🌟

随着移动互联网的飞速发展,小程序作为一种轻量级的应用,越来越受到人们的喜爱,小程序不仅使用方便,而且开发起来相对简单,我就为大家分享一个简易小程序开发的例子,让大家轻松入门小程序开发。

🌈项目背景

假设我们要开发一个简易的天气预报小程序,这个小程序可以实时显示当前城市的天气状况,包括温度、湿度、风力等信息。

🔧开发工具

  1. 开发环境:Windows或Mac操作系统,支持微信开发者工具。
  2. 开发语言:JavaScript(WXML、WXSS、JS)。

🌟开发步骤

  1. 注册小程序账号:在微信公众平台注册小程序账号,获取AppID。

  2. 创建小程序项目:打开微信开发者工具,点击“新建项目”,输入AppID,选择项目名称和目录,点击“确定”。

  3. 设计页面布局

    打开“pages”目录下的“index”文件夹,编辑“index.wxml”文件,添加以下代码:

<view class="container">
  <view class="weather">
    <text>当前城市:</text>
    <input type="text" value="{{city}}" bindinput="onCityInput" />
  </view>
  <view class="info">
    <text>温度:</text>
    <text>{{temp}}℃</text>
  </view>
  <view class="info">
    <text>湿度:</text>
    <text>{{hum}}%</text>
  </view>
  <view class="info">
    <text>风力:</text>
    <text>{{wind}}级</text>
  </view>
</view>
  1. 编写样式

    打开“pages”目录下的“index”文件夹,编辑“index.wxss”文件,添加以下样式:

.container {
  padding: 20px;
}
.weather {
  margin-bottom: 10px;
}
.info {
  margin-bottom: 10px;
}
  1. 编写逻辑

    打开“pages”目录下的“index”文件夹,编辑“index.js”文件,添加以下代码:

Page({
  data: {
    city: '北京',
    temp: '',
    hum: '',
    wind: ''
  },
  onCityInput: function(e) {
    this.setData({
      city: e.detail.value
    });
  },
  onLoad: function() {
    this.getWeather();
  },
  getWeather: function() {
    const city = this.data.city;
    wx.request({
      url: `https://api.weatherapi.com/v1/current.json?key=YOUR_API_KEY&q=${city}`,
      method: 'GET',
      success: res => {
        const temp = res.data.current.temp_c;
        const hum = res.data.current.humidity;
        const wind = res.data.current.wind_kph;
        this.setData({
          temp: temp,
          hum: hum,
          wind: wind
        });
      }
    });
  }
});
  1. 预览小程序:点击微信开发者工具中的“预览”按钮,在手机上查看效果。

通过以上步骤,我们成功开发了一个简易的天气预报小程序,这个例子展示了小程序的基本开发流程,希望对大家有所帮助,实际开发过程中,还需要根据需求添加更多功能,如城市选择、历史天气查询等,祝大家在小程序开发的道路上越走越远!🚀

小程序设计

文山税务小程序开发项目

智慧税务新时代的探索与实践随着互联网技术的飞速发展,移动应用已成为人们日常生活中不可或缺的一部分,在税务领域,为了提高工作效率,优化纳税服务,文山税务部门积极响应国家政策,启动了文山税务小程序开发...

微信小程序游戏开发一个多少钱啊

价格几何?随着移动互联网的飞速发展,微信小程序凭借其便捷性和强大的用户基础,成为了众多开发者眼中的香饽饽,尤其是游戏开发领域,微信小程序游戏因其独特的社交属性和易于传播的特点,吸引了大量开发者的关...

成都小程序开发应用公司

助力企业数字化转型随着移动互联网的快速发展,小程序作为一种轻量级的应用程序,逐渐成为企业数字化转型的重要工具,成都,作为我国西南地区的经济、文化、科技中心,拥有一批优秀的小程序开发应用公司,为众多...

微信配送物料小程序开发

提升物流效率,优化用户体验随着互联网技术的飞速发展,微信已成为人们日常生活中不可或缺的一部分,在物流配送领域,微信配送物料小程序的开发应运而生,它不仅极大地提升了物流效率,还为广大用户带来了便捷的...

北京代驾小程序开发技术

北京代驾小程序开发技术探析随着互联网技术的不断发展,小程序作为一种轻量级应用,逐渐走进了我们的生活,在众多行业应用中,代驾服务成为了小程序的重要应用场景之一,本文将为您揭秘北京代驾小程序的开发技术...

鼓楼区小程序开发中

鼓楼区小程序开发中的创新与挑战随着移动互联网的飞速发展,小程序作为一种轻量级的应用程序,正逐渐成为人们日常生活的重要组成部分,在这样一个大背景下,鼓楼区的小程序开发也迎来了前所未有的机遇和挑战。...

微信小程序开发审批工具

提升效率,保障质量随着移动互联网的快速发展,微信小程序凭借其便捷性、易用性和强大的社交属性,成为了众多企业和开发者关注的焦点,在微信小程序的开发过程中,如何确保项目的质量和效率,成为了开发者面临的...

马拉松报名小程序开发

创新报名方式,助力全民健身随着全民健身理念的深入人心,马拉松赛事在我国各地纷纷举办,为方便广大跑者报名参赛,提高赛事组织效率,近年来,马拉松报名小程序逐渐兴起,本文将探讨马拉松报名小程序的开发过程...

自己开发小程序卖产品

自己开发小程序,开启产品销售的全新征程在移动互联网高速发展的今天,小程序已经成为人们生活中不可或缺的一部分,随着微信、支付宝等平台的普及,越来越多的商家开始尝试自己开发小程序,以实现产品的线上销售...

智慧印刷小程序开发流程

智慧印刷小程序开发流程解析随着互联网技术的飞速发展,小程序已经成为企业提升服务效率、拓展市场的重要工具,在印刷行业,智慧印刷小程序的开发更是顺应了行业数字化转型的大趋势,本文将为您详细解析智慧印刷...

惠州小程序开发培训

开启数字化创业新篇章随着移动互联网的飞速发展,小程序作为一种轻量级的应用程序,因其便捷、高效的特点,逐渐成为企业数字化转型的重要工具,惠州,这座位于广东省东部的美丽城市,也正迎来小程序开发培训的热...

肇庆心理小程序开发专业

守护心灵健康的科技助手随着互联网技术的飞速发展,智能手机已成为人们日常生活中不可或缺的工具,在这个信息爆炸的时代,心理健康问题日益凸显,如何有效预防和解决心理问题成为社会关注的焦点,肇庆心理小程序...

小虎牙

小虎牙

TA太懒了...暂时没有任何简介

小程序开发